Lea Michele reveals Finn tattoo to honor Cory Monteith
- TV Show
It’s been three years since Cory Monteith died, but his Glee costar and girlfriend Lea Michele continues to honor him in permanent ways.
The Scream Queens star appears on the cover of Women’s Health U.K.‘s Naked Issue, revealing a small “Finn” tattoo on her left butt cheek. The tat marks a blending of fiction and reality, as Michele’s character on Glee, Rachel Berry, got a “Finn” tattoo on the show to honor the passing of her former fiancé, Monteith’s character Finn Hudson.
“Right now, I feel physically in my best shape, and emotionally in my best place,” she told the magazine, later noting, “I have down days. I accept those days as much as the happy ones.”
Michele has at least two other tattoos to honor Monteith. She unveiled a number 5, Finn’s football number on Glee, in April. The “if you say so” ink on her ribcage recalls the last thing Monteith said to her before his death — it completed their exchange and followed her saying, “I love you more.”
On July 13, the third anniversary of Monteith’s death, Michele took to Twitter to share her grief. “I know everyday you’re watching over me, and smiling,” she said. “Love and miss you Cory, everyday, but today a little more.”
